Development of a micro controlled deformation gauge with a communication interface

Abstract

The project aims to develop a deformation gauge for application both in test laboratories and the research of new materials and in the civil engineering structures. The desired equipment will have a very precise measurement system (better than 0.1 per cent) and high resolution (1 micrometer/meter), the functions of which will be monitored and controlled by a microcomputer control system. Furthermore, a communication interface will be made available compatible with standard IBM/PC microcomputers, so as to facilitate the analysis of the data through specific software programs. Since it possesses predominantly digital properties, the intention is to implement several of its circuits by means of matrixes of logic circuits (FPGA), which are more efficient, consume less power and occupy less space. The conclusion of this project will deliver into the national market a quality product of flexible use, and high technological value, since at the moment no other such manufacturer exists in this market. The equipment has guaranteed applications in the areas of materials testing and the monitoring of civil engineering works. (AU)
